华为云代理商:csv导入mysql

华为云代理商:CSV导入MySQL的便捷方法

在现代数据管理中,如何高效、精准地将CSV文件导入到MySQL数据库中是许多开发者和数据管理员面临的挑战。对于华为云代理商而言,结合华为云的优势,如何利用其云服务来实现高效的数据导入,成为提升服务质量的重要一环。本文将详细介绍如何在华为云环境下,利用云服务器和MySQL数据库实现CSV数据的快速导入,并展示华为云产品的优势。

一、华为云优势:强大的云基础设施

华为云提供了一整套完备的云计算服务,确保高效、安全、稳定的运行环境,特别适用于数据密集型应用和数据库操作。其云服务器(ECS)不仅具有高性能的计算能力,还提供了自动化的管理工具,帮助用户快速部署和管理数据库。

华为云的优势包括:

  • 高性能的计算能力:华为云的云服务器采用最新的计算硬件,提供强大的CPU和内存配置,确保MySQL数据库能够高效处理大量数据。
  • 灵活的扩展性:根据实际需求,华为云能够灵活扩展计算资源和存储空间,为数据导入和处理提供无缝支持。
  • 高安全性:华为云通过多层次的安全措施,保障用户数据的安全性,包括防火墙、DDoS防护以及数据加密等。
  • 便捷的管理工具:华为云提供了丰富的管理工具,支持通过图形界面或命令行轻松管理数据库和服务器,简化了数据导入过程。

二、CSV数据导入MySQL的常用方法

CSV文件因其结构简单、易于读取,成为了数据交换和存储中常用的格式之一。在将CSV数据导入MySQL时,通常有两种常见的方法:

  • 使用LOAD DATA INFILE命令:这是MySQL提供的原生功能,通过该命令可以高效地将CSV文件直接导入到MySQL数据库中。
  • 使用MySQL Workbench导入:对于不熟悉命令行的用户,MySQL Workbench提供了图形化界面,可以方便地完成数据导入操作。

接下来,我们将详细介绍如何在华为云服务器环境中,利用MySQL的这些方法进行CSV导入。

1. 使用LOAD DATA INFILE命令导入CSV

在华为云上部署好MySQL数据库后,首先将CSV文件上传至云服务器,然后使用LOAD DATA INFILE命令导入。步骤如下:

  1. 上传CSV文件:通过SFTP工具或华为云提供的对象存储服务(OBS),将CSV文件上传到服务器。
  2. 连接到MySQL数据库:使用MySQL客户端工具(如MySQL Workbench或命令行)连接到华为云的MySQL实例。
  3. 执行导入命令:执行以下SQL命令,将CSV文件中的数据导入到指定的表格中:
            LOAD DATA INFILE '/path/to/your/file.csv'
            INTO TABLE your_table
            FIELDS TERMINATED BY ',' 
            LINES TERMINATED BY 'n'
            IGNORE 1 LINES;
            

    其中,/path/to/your/file.csv为CSV文件的存放路径,your_table为目标表名。IGNORE 1 LINES是忽略CSV文件的第一行(通常是标题行)。

2. 使用MySQL Workbench导入CSV

如果您不想使用命令行,可以通过MySQL Workbench图形化工具进行导入。步骤如下:

  1. 打开MySQL Workbench:启动MySQL Workbench并连接到您的华为云MySQL实例。
  2. 选择数据库和表:选择要导入数据的数据库和目标表格。
  3. 导入CSV文件:右键点击目标表格,选择“Table Data Import Wizard”。在弹出的窗口中选择CSV文件并设置导入选项。
  4. 完成导入:点击“Next”,系统将自动将CSV文件中的数据导入到目标表格。

三、结合华为云服务器产品优化导入性能

虽然MySQL本身提供了高效的数据导入功能,但在大规模数据导入时,仍然会受到网络带宽、磁盘IO等因素的影响。通过合理配置华为云服务器资源,能够进一步提升数据导入的性能。

  • 选择合适的云服务器规格:根据数据量和并发需求,选择合适的云服务器配置。例如,选择更多CPU核心和更高内存配置,以加快数据处理速度。
  • 使用云数据库MySQL:华为云提供的云数据库MySQL(RDS)具有自动化管理、故障恢复、备份等功能,能够保障数据库高可用,提升数据导入的稳定性。
  • 优化存储配置:华为云提供SSD云硬盘,具有高性能的存储能力,可以有效减少磁盘IO瓶颈,提升数据导入速度。
  • 利用华为云的内容分发网络(CDN):在数据导入过程中,利用华为云CDN可以加速数据从客户端到云服务器的传输,提升导入效率。

四、总结

在数据处理的过程中,CSV文件作为一种常见的数据交换格式,其导入MySQL的需求非常普遍。通过华为云提供的强大基础设施和云产品,用户可以高效、稳定地完成CSV数据导入任务。无论是通过LOAD DATA INFILE命令,还是借助MySQL Workbench,华为云的云服务器和数据库都为用户提供了可靠的性能和灵活性。

华为云代理商:csv导入mysql

通过合理配置华为云服务器资源、优化存储配置和选择合适的数据库实例,可以大幅提升数据导入效率,为用户带来更加高效和便捷的使用体验。作为华为云的代理商,了解并掌握这些技术方法,不仅能够为客户提供专业的技术支持,也能帮助他们在云端环境中更好地管理和处理数据。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/251895.html

(0)
luotuoemo的头像luotuoemo
上一篇 2025年3月25日 00:50
下一篇 2025年3月25日 00:52

相关推荐

  • 华为云代理商:查看端口列表

    华为云代理商:查看端口列表 一、介绍华为云服务器产品 华为云是华为公司推出的云计算服务平台,致力于为用户提供高性能、可靠性和安全性的云计算基础设施。华为云服务器产品包括弹性云服务器、裸金属服务器、GPU服务器等多种类型,满足不同业务场景的需求。 二、华为云代理商的角色 作为华为云的代理商,您可以为客户提供华为云产品的咨询、购买、配置和管理等服务。作为代理商,…

    2024年10月1日
    34000
  • 华为云国际站:hadoop mapreduce log

    华为云国际站:高效处理Hadoop MapReduce日志的优势解析 一、Hadoop MapReduce日志管理的重要性 在当今大数据时代,Hadoop MapReduce作为分布式计算的核心框架,广泛应用于海量数据处理。然而,其运行过程中产生的日志数据规模庞大且分散,如何高效收集、存储和分析这些日志成为企业面临的关键挑战。华为云国际站凭借领先的技术实力和…

    2025年9月18日
    10500
  • 昆明华为云代理商:安卓测试机

    昆明华为云代理商:安卓测试机 介绍 作为昆明华为云的代理商,我们致力于为客户提供高质量的云计算产品和服务。其中,安卓测试机是我们推荐的一款产品,可以帮助客户快速、高效地进行安卓应用程序的测试和开发。 产品特点 安卓测试机具有以下特点: 强大的性能:安卓测试机采用华为云服务器,拥有强大的CPU和内存,可以保证测试应用程序的稳定性和高效性。 灵活的配置:用户可以…

    2024年4月3日
    30400
  • 华为云国际站代理商注册:canvas常用api

    在华为云国际站注册代理商账户后,您可以使用以下Canvas API来进行图形绘制和操作。Canvas API主要用于在HTML5画布(<canvas>元素)上进行2D绘图。下面是一些常用的Canvas API: 创建和获取Canvas上下文 // 获取canvas元素 var canvas = document.getElementById(&#…

    2024年7月15日
    32800
  • 华为云代理商:cdn网络部署架构

    华为云代理商:CDN网络部署架构 随着互联网技术的迅猛发展,越来越多的企业在数字化转型的过程中开始重视网络加速和内容分发的技术。CDN(内容分发网络)作为提高网络性能和用户体验的关键技术,已经成为了企业在全球范围内进行内容交付的必备工具。作为全球领先的云计算提供商,华为云凭借其强大的技术背景和丰富的产品线,提供了高效、稳定且易于部署的CDN网络解决方案。本章…

    2025年3月25日
    18900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/